Sims excessively flirt with others

Sims automatically perform certain romantic actions, even if they have a dislike for those actions. Because of this, relationship satisfaction drops very quickly. 
Example: A Sim automatically flirts with their partner, even though both of them are dissatisfied with flirting. Relationship satisfaction drops, and as a result, the Sims start arguing.

  • I've noticed that my Sims are using romantic interactions autonomously such as flirting, blowing a kiss, etc. more often after the September 18th update. These sims do not have romance bars, do not have romantic or lovebug traits, and are not in flirty moods.

    I have unflirty sims using romantic interactions frequently, and even sad sims are using romantic interactions which should be locked. I have tested this by turning off mods in the game settings and taking out mods altogether but the bug seems to persist.

    Any advice is welcome. Thank you!

  • I'm having this issue too, where sims that dislike flirting (as an example, but it also applies to the other categories) will still autonomously do those actions, then become Unsatisfied as a result. It seems that sims should NOT autonomously do the interactions that they dislike - it's a huge flaw with the system and makes dating so frustrating. I'm on PS5 so no mods.

  • I apologize, I’m writing through a translator, and it seems I didn’t phrase the issue well. The problem is that Sims in a relationship (let’s say two characters) both have a dislike for flirting, but in Live Mode, they automatically flirt with each other (not cheating), and because of this, their relationship satisfaction drops. The issue is specifically that they themselves initiate flirting with each other, even though neither of them likes it.
